Post by 5 BASS LIMIT on Feb 2, 2008 1:17:36 GMT -1
basschaser , STOP!!!!! Do not run it any more unless you want to replace the whole powerhead. It might just need a new piston and rering the engine you want know untill you tear it down and inspect the internal parts. If you cotinue to run the engine you will do more damage than good and it is cheaper to replace a few parts than a new powerhead.
